Transcribed Image Text:3) Which of the following statements about the minimum spanning tree (MST) problem is/are correct?
A. We can use Prim's algorithm to solve the MST problem, and it is basically an algorithm of dynamic
programming (DP).
B. We can use Kruskal's algorithm to solve the MST problem, and it is basically an algorithm of DP.
C. We can formulate the MST problem as a linear program.
D. Any pair of nodes in the MST of any graph must be connected.
Е.
None of the above are correct.
